News Release: The Bureau of Land Management Wyoming State Office has posted its proposed list of parcels for the quarterly competitive oil and gas lease sale scheduled for Tuesday, February 7, 2017. The sale will be held at the Radisson Hotel in Cheyenne Wyoming. Doors open at 7 a.m. with the auction beginning at 8 a.m.
